Amibroker Data: Sources, Quality, & Optimization

Acquiring high-quality data for Amibroker involves careful evaluation of potential origins. Frequently used options encompass premium suppliers, free web repositories, and even manually inputted records. However, the quality of this data can fluctuate significantly; free sources are often susceptible to errors or lacking details. Improving data delivery within Amibroker often requires adjusting parameters like update frequency and handling voids in the information set. In conclusion, thorough validation and routine purging of your trading data is vital for accurate study and profitable investing plans.
